Discover LudwigThe phrase "a separate tray"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to a distinct or individual tray that is not combined with others, often in contexts like serving food or organizing items.
Example: "Please place the salad in a separate tray to avoid mixing it with the main course."
Alternatives: "an individual tray" or "a distinct tray".
